Concrete definition Presently, concrete is Probably the most common construction materials Employed in building engineering all over the whole world. It can be composed of wonderful and coarse aggregate bonded together with a fluid cement (cement paste) that hardens over the time. The aggregates are often sand and gravel (or crushed stone), even though the paste is water and portland cement.

To start with, maintain the trowel Practically flat, elevating the primary concrete slabs lowes edge just enough to avoid gouging the floor. On Every successive move, lift the leading edge on the trowel somewhat more. If you want a rougher, nonslip surface, you could skip the steel trowel altogether. As an alternative, drag a force broom over the floor to create a “broom finish.”
